(20 November 2018, Honolulu, Hawaii) - The Philippine Consulate General in Honolulu conducted a consular outreach mission in Maui on 17-18 November 2018 at the Maui County Business Center. The consular outreach team headed Deputy Consul General Angelica C. Escalona was able to process 173 passport applications, 70 applications for dual citizenship and 17 documents for notarization during the one and a half day event.

This was the ninth consular outreach conducted by the Consulate in 2018 in areas under its jurisdiction. END
